PhanDad 3,616 Posted February 11, 2017 My AC Homelite is a "cousin" to this tractor. IMO, it's a better mowing machine for the dead of summer since the cut can be raised up to an inch higher than a Sovereign's deck (lucky to get 3 inch cut). Many of the mechanicals are the same as Simplicity, so the mechanical parts are readily available. The sheet metal and most attachments are different and harder to find. Make sure the deck mule drive is included or you won't be able to mow. And the front PTO is more critical than the electric lift mentioned above. Without a functioning front electric PTO, you don't mow or blow snow.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
